如何看自己登过的服务器

fiy 其他 44

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看自己登过的服务器,首先需要了解一些基础知识。服务器是一个计算机程序,它接受来自其他设备(如个人电脑、手机等)的请求,并提供相应的服务。登陆服务器意味着连接到服务器并获得对其进行操作的权限。

    下面是一些步骤来查看自己登过的服务器。

    1. 登陆记录查询

      在大多数操作系统中,登陆服务器的行为都会被记录在系统的登陆日志中。你可以通过查看这些登陆日志来了解自己登过的服务器。

      在Linux系统中,登陆日志通常存储在/var/log/auth.log或/var/log/secure文件中。你可以使用以下命令来查看日志文件:

      cat /var/log/auth.log
      

      这个命令将显示登陆日志的内容,包括登陆时间、登陆用户和登陆设备的IP地址等信息。

      在Windows系统中,登陆日志通常存储在Event Viewer(事件查看器)中。你可以按下Win + X键,然后选择Event Viewer打开事件查看器,然后在左侧的树形目录中选择Windows Logs -> Security即可查看登陆日志。

    2. SSH登陆记录

      如果你是通过SSH(Secure Shell)协议远程登陆服务器,那么SSH服务器会记录登陆日志。你可以通过查看SSH日志来了解自己登过的服务器。

      在Linux系统中,SSH登陆日志通常存储在/var/log/secure或/var/log/auth.log文件中。你可以使用以下命令来查看日志文件:

      cat /var/log/secure
      

      在Windows系统中,SSH登陆日志通常存储在Event Viewer(事件查看器)的Windows Logs -> Security目录中,你可以使用与上述相同的方法查看SSH登陆日志。

    3. 系统监控工具

      除了上述方法之外,你还可以使用系统监控工具来查看自己登过的服务器。这些工具可以提供实时的服务器登陆信息,包括登陆用户、登陆时间和登陆设备的IP地址等。

      在Linux系统中,常用的系统监控工具有top、htop和glances等。你可以使用这些工具来查看服务器的登陆情况。

      在Windows系统中,你可以使用类似于Task Manager(任务管理器)的工具来查看服务器登陆情况。

    总结起来,要查看自己登过的服务器,你可以通过登陆记录查询、SSH登陆记录和系统监控工具等方法。这些方法可以提供登陆服务器的详细信息,帮助你了解自己的登陆历史。记得要妥善保护自己的服务器登陆凭证,避免被他人非法登陆。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看自己登过的服务器,您可以采取以下几个步骤:

    1. 使用服务器访问日志:服务器通常会记录所有访问请求的日志。您可以通过查看这些日志来确定自己是否曾经登录过服务器。访问日志通常记录用户的IP地址、访问时间和使用的登录凭据。

    2. 检查系统日志:服务器的操作系统通常会生成系统日志,记录所有用户登录和注销的信息。您可以查看系统日志,找到自己过去登录服务器的记录。

    3. 查看SSH日志:如果您是使用SSH协议登录服务器,服务器通常会记录SSH连接的日志。您可以查看这些日志,以确定自己是否曾经通过SSH登录服务器。

    4. 查看登录历史记录:服务器可以记录登录历史记录,包括登录用户名、登录时间和登录来源等信息。您可以通过查看登录历史记录,找到自己过去登录服务器的信息。

    5. 使用安全信息和事件管理系统:一些服务器可能配备了安全信息和事件管理系统(SIEM),这些系统可以集中管理服务器日志,并提供搜索和过滤功能。通过使用SIEM系统,您可以更轻松地查找自己过去登录服务器的记录。

    需要注意的是,上述方法可能需要一定的权限和技术知识。如果您无法直接访问服务器或不熟悉服务器的操作,可以向系统管理员或网络管理员寻求帮助。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看自己曾经登陆过的服务器,可以通过以下方法:

    1. 使用命令行工具

    在Windows系统中,可以打开命令提示符(cmd)或者PowerShell,输入命令:ssh-add -l 或者 ssh-add -L,查看已经添加的SSH密钥。这个命令会列出所有已经加载到ssh-agent的密钥,其中包括你曾经登陆过的服务器的密钥。

    在Linux或者Mac系统中,同样可以打开终端,输入命令:ssh-add -l 或者 ssh-add -L。同样会列出已经加载到ssh-agent的密钥。

    1. 查看SSH客户端配置文件

    登陆过的服务器的相关信息通常存储在SSH客户端配置文件中,可以通过编辑这个文件来查看登陆过的服务器记录。

    在Windows系统中,SSH客户端配置文件通常位于用户目录的.ssh目录下,文件名为config。可以使用文本编辑器打开该文件,查找相关记录。

    在Linux或者Mac系统中,SSH客户端配置文件同样位于用户目录的.ssh目录下,文件名为config。同样可以使用文本编辑器打开该文件,查找登陆记录。

    1. 寻找SSH历史文件

    SSH客户端通常会保存用户登陆过的服务器的历史记录,可以通过查找SSH历史文件来查看。

    在Windows系统中,SSH历史文件通常位于用户目录的.ssh目录下,文件名为known_hosts。可以使用文本编辑器打开该文件,查找相关记录。

    在Linux或者Mac系统中,SSH历史文件同样位于用户目录的.ssh目录下,文件名为known_hosts。同样可以使用文本编辑器打开该文件,查找登陆记录。

    1. 使用第三方工具

    还有一些第三方工具可以帮助查看登陆过的服务器记录。比如在Windows系统中,可以使用PuTTY等工具来查看登陆记录。

    总结起来,通过命令行工具、SSH客户端配置文件、SSH历史文件以及第三方工具等方法,都可以查看自己登陆过的服务器记录。选择一种适合自己的方法来查找记录并进行查询即可。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部